WebDictionary entry overview: What does manumitter mean? • MANUMITTER (noun) The noun MANUMITTER has 1 sense: 1. someone who frees others from bondage. Familiarity … WebMANUMISSION, contracts. The agreement by which the owner or master of a slave sets him free and at liberty; the written instrument which contains this agreement is also called a manumission. 2. In the civil law it was different from emancipation, which, properly speaking, was applied to the liberation of children from paternal power.
